Role Overview As a Senior Data Analytics Engineer based in Amsterdam, you will transform raw data into a strategic asset for the company. While the DataOps team builds the core infrastructure, this role focuses on developing the analytical framework that supports financial reporting, product forecasting, and go-to-market planning. The position connects technical infrastructure with business leadership, ensuring every department has reliable, self-service access to the data needed for quick decision-making. Your First Year First 3 months: Get to know the current technology stack (GCP, BigQuery, Airbyte, dbt), core business data models, and any data flow challenges. Deliver and refine initial high-priority models for product usage and financial reporting. Work closely with the Data Engineer to align on the new infrastructure roadmap. By 6 months: Build a semantic layer to standardize KPIs across the company. Lay the groundwork for AI-readiness and enable advanced natural language querying. After 1 year: Take full ownership of the company’s data modeling architecture. Ensure it supports AI and machine learning applications. Advise department heads by using data to shape long-term growth and forecasting strategies, while maintaining a governed data environment that gives business users confidence to explore data on their own. Key Responsibilities Data Product Ownership: Manage the full lifecycle of internal data products. Work with stakeholders to turn business questions into technical solutions, choosing the right tools to keep reporting scalable and accessible. Analytics Engineering: Design, build, and maintain core data models using dbt Labs. Develop the logic for critical datasets, including those used for financial reporting, churn forecasting, and reverse-ETL processes that sync warehouse data with business tools like Planhat and HubSpot. Data Governance and Semantic Layering: Uphold data integrity by implementing governance standards and developing the semantic layer to ensure consistent metrics across the company. Data Enablement: Partner with RevOps to create training and documentation that helps teams in Finance, Product, and GTM work independently with data products.
